使用 ForceNewPage 屬性來指定表單區段是否 (頁首、詳細資料、頁尾) 或報表區段 (頁首、詳細資料、頁尾) 列印在個別頁面上,而不是在目前頁面上列印。 可讀寫的 Byte。
語法
表達。強制新頁面
詞 代表 Section 物件的變數。
註解
例如,您已經設計到訂單表單報表的最後一頁。 如果報表頁尾的 ForceNewPage 屬性設為 Before Section (區段前),則訂單表單永遠會列印在新的一頁上。
ForceNewPage 屬性並不適用於頁首或頁尾。
ForceNewPage 屬性使用下列設定值。
| 設定 | Visual Basic | 描述 |
|---|---|---|
| 無 | 0 | (預設) 目前區段 (您要設定屬性的區段) 列印在目前頁面上。 |
| 在區段前 | 1 | 目前區段列印在新頁的最頂端。 |
| 在區段後 | 2 | 目前區段的下一個區段列印在新頁的最頂端。 |
| 前與後 | 3 | 目前區段列印在新頁的最頂端,下一個區段也是列印在新頁的最頂端。 |
以下是 ForceNewPage 屬性設定的一些範例。
| 區段 | 範例設定值 | 描述 |
|---|---|---|
| 群組首顯示年份 | 在區段前 | 群組首列印在頁的最頂端,後面接著詳細資料區段、群組尾和頁尾。 |
| 報表詳細資料區段 | 在區段後 | 群組尾列印在新頁的最頂端。 |
| 包含報表標題和公司標誌的報表標題 | 在區段後 | 報表標題和公司圖案列印在報表開頭分頁符號的最頂端。 |
範例
下列範例會傳回 [依日期銷售] 報表詳細資料區段的 ForceNewPage 屬性設定,並將它指派給intGetVal變數。
Dim intGetVal As Integer
intGetVal = Reports![Sales By Date].Section(acDetail).ForceNewPage
支援和意見反應
有關於 Office VBA 或這份文件的問題或意見反應嗎? 如需取得支援服務並提供意見反應的相關指導,請參閱 Office VBA 支援與意見反應。